3 Nov 2022 ... I bonds, which are U.S. savings bonds, also carry a 30-year fixed rate in addition to the variable, inflation-adjusted rate. From May 2020 ...

The fixed rate on I bonds was 0% between May 2020 and November 2022, when it was finally raised to 0.4%. The latest increase to 0.9% marks the highest fixed rate since 2008. You can make a one ...

The fixed rate for I Bonds issued in November 2023 is 1.30%. The semi-annual inflation rate is 3.94%. When you combine the two, and the fixed rate itself gets an inflation adjustment, you get the composite rate of 5.27%. Here is the exact math on the I Bond composite rate: [0.0130 + (2 x 0.0197) + (0.0130 x 0.0197)] = 5.27%.For long-term I Bond holders, the I Bond fixed rate is essential.
